Sonarqube is a code quality checking tool. Using sonar to scan the code we have written can help check the bugs, standardization and robustness of the code, which helps to improve the quality of our code. 1. Install DockerAfter the installation is complete, enter the command line docker -v When the version number appears, the installation is complete. . . . . . . . . 2. Install sonar image1. Enter in the command line docker -search sonar You will see many sonar versions: 2. We use the command directly, docker pull sonar downloads the latest version of sonarqube by default docker pull sonar After the download is complete, execute docker images to view the downloaded image files. Already have sonarqube. 3. Run sonar Command line input docker run -p9000:9000 sonarqube The default port of sonar is 9000. Map the port 9000 in the docker image to the host port 9000. At this time, we open the browser and enter the URL localhost:9000 to enter the docker page. The default login account and password are both admin. At this point, our sonar installation and operation is complete. 4. Persistent Sonar If you need to persist our sonar scan data, you can use the following command to start sonar. The jdbc information is the mysql connection, username and password. Sonar will persist the scan information to MySQL. docker run --restart=always -d --name sonarqube \ -p 9000:9000 \ -e sonar.jdbc.username=root \ -e sonar.jdbc.password=123456 \ -e sonar.jdbc.url= jdbc:mysql://172.30.50.215:3306/payment?useUnicode=true&characterEncoding=UTF-8 \sonarqube 3. Use sonar to scan codeAfter logging in to the sonar page, click to create a project Click manually. You can also select GitHub here. Using git to associate sonar with your project makes it easier to scan code branches. Then enter a project name at random. It is recommended to make it the same as the project name. Enter anything (it is recommended to be the same as the project name) to generate a token. After generation, click continue. Choose maven or gradle, or others according to our project location. Sonar will automatically give the command to scan the code below. Then open our idea and execute it in the command line below. There is a pitfall here. Since sonar will scan our class files in the target directory, we need to package the project first. mvn -package Then scan again. After the scan is complete, return to localhost:9000 and you can see the quality problems in our code. Note: The latest version (5.7 and above) of SonarQube no longer supports MySQL.
